Transaction b6a12896325dafa92051001038bf80c4eac5e9468904148bbec4e4982a478a1e
1 Input
1 Output
-
b6a12896325dafa92051001038bf80c4eac5e9468904148bbec4e4982a478a1e:0
- value
- 377800
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5e7f3c2453d76489f6b424b1b4d357223eec1d2
- address
- bc1q6hnl8sj984my38mtgf93knf4wg37aswjdqzs95